Addition Rule
The addition rule is a fundamental principle in probability that determines the probability of the union of two events happening, considering both their individual probabilities and their intersection.
Lightning
A natural, high-voltage electrical discharge occurring within a cloud, between clouds or between a cloud and the ground.
